Ensuring a Sober and Safe Holiday Season: National Impaired Driving Prevention Month Guide
December is designated as National Impaired Driving Prevention Month, also known as National Drunk and Drugged Driving (3D) Prevention Month. This period aims to raise awareness about impaired driving and promote actions to address this pressing concern.
